Amateur Baseball: Red Wing Aces 5 Hastings Hawks 0- The Aces played one of their most complete games of the season in a CCVL win over the Hawks Sunday night at the Athletic Field. Aaron Johnson pitched 6 1/3 innings of two hit ball with two walks and five strikeouts to get the win for the Aces. Dustin La Rue and Augie Lindmark eached pitched 1 1/3 innings of scorless relief. The Aces took a 1-0 lead in the second inning off Hawks starter Derrick Pfeffer. Brett Gadient singled and went to third base when Andy Schilling reached on an error by Hawks third baseman Sean Dube. Schilling was picked off of first base by Pfeffer, but stayed in the run down long enough to allow Gadient to score from third base on the play. A late afternoon thunderstorm caused a 75 minute rain delay in the top of the third inning but when played resumed the Aces wasted little time in adding to their lead. Cory Thorson's two out liner to short was dropped by the Hawks Wes Hedlund and Jimmy Bohmbach followed with a two run homer to right field off Pfeffer to put the Aces up 3-0 in the bottom of the third inning. Thorson singled in the fifth inning and scored on Bohmbach's opposite field double to left to make it 4-0. The Aces final run came in the seventh inning. Kyle Blahnik doubled with one out and went to third on Thorson's third single of the game. Adam Barta came on to pitch for Hastings and was greeted by Bohmbach's single to right that scored courtesy runner Jordan Warren. Bohmbach was 3-4 with 4 RBI for the Aces. Cory Thorson was 3-4 with five other players getting one hit apiece. The Aces also turned three doubleplays and centerfielder Steve Boldt made two fine catches on back to back plays in the seventh inning. The Aces are now 20-10 overall and 9-3 in the CCVL. Hastings is 14-10 overall and 4-6 in the CCVL. The Aces host St. Paul Sport & Spine Tuesday at 7:30pm in their next game. Lake City 16 Plainview 3 (7 innings)- Kris Long had five RBI , Matt Foley 3 RBI and Matt Sandstrom tossed a complete game on the mound for the Serpents. Lake City is now 19-3 on the season. Cannon Falls 4 Savage 3- Luke Winchell's RBI double in the bottom of the ninth inning was the game winner for the Bears. Cannon Falls is 15-12 on the season. Miesville 6 Bay City 2- The Mudhens scored all six of their runs in the first two innings and cruised to the home win Sunday. Miesville is 22-3 on the season. St. Croix Falls 7 Hager City 4 (11 innings)- Chase Mellstrom's three run homer in the bottom of the ninth inning tied the game for the Skeeters but St. Croix Falls scored three in the 11th inning for the win. American Legion Baseball: Red Wing 19 Lonsdale7 (6 innings)- Colin Mc Kim was 4-5 with two home runs and a staggering nine RBI for Red Wing. Coleman Kelly was the winning pitcher and also had two RBI. Ryan Hill added two RBI for Post 54 in the win.
